Bailiff Bridge
Bailiff Bridge is a village 1.5 miles north from Brighouse, West Yorkshire, England, and is 5 miles from Huddersfield and 7 miles from Bradford. Bailiff Bridge lies in the unparished area of the borough of Calderdale, who are responsible for all local government activity in the village and surrounding areas.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Lightcliffe is a village in the Calderdale district in West Yorkshire, England. Historically part of the West Riding of Yorkshire, it is situated approximately three miles east of Halifax and two miles north west of Brighouse.

Thornhills is a hamlet in the Calderdale district, in the county of West Yorkshire, England. It is near the town of Brighouse. In 2023, Calderdale Council adopted a plan to build 3,000 new homes on land at Thornhills and Woodhouse.

Scholes is a village near Cleckheaton, West Yorkshire, England. The village is 5 miles south of Bradford between Wyke and Cleckheaton near to the M62 motorway.
